Why Lemons in cleaning of kitchen?
![]() |
| why lemon in kitchen |
There are various reasons why lemon is a widely used element in natural detergents.
1. Natural Disinfectant:
The acidic nature of lemons helps to eradicate germs and bacteria from kitchen surfaces. a fantastic natural disinfection substitute for chemical.
2. Odor Eliminator:
Odors are successfully neutralized by the crisp, clean aroma of lemon. A few lemon peels, for instance, can help your garbage disposal smell better
3. Stain remover:
Lemon is also an excellent stain remover for a variety of surfaces, such as: chopping board.
4.Degreaser:
The lemon's citric acid dissolves grease and oil, making it simpler to clean soiled dishes, ovens, and stoves.
5. Non-toxic:
Lemons are safer for households, especially those with kids and pets, because they are non-toxic when compared to many commercial cleaning chemicals.
6. Budget-friendly:
Citrus fruits are inexpensive multipurpose friends in kitchen.
Homemade Lemon Recipe for Green Dishwasher
![]() |
| Lemon in kitchen |
What supplies do I need to get ready for dishwasher?
Two cups borax, two cups detergent, half a cup citric acid, half a cup coarse salt, and the zest of two lemons
Prepration:
In a bowl, combine first all the dry ingredients listed above. Then add lemon zest in it. Grate the exterior yellow section of the lemon; the white half is bitter. It is recommended to store this mixture in a closed container. Take out two tablespoons of the mixture for every dishwasher load.
To determine what works best , we advise exploring a variety of approaches.
Shelf life of dishwashers
Since every part is dry, it can be kept for a few months. But to keep it potent, store it in an airtight jar in a cool, dark place to avoid agglomeration.
Homemade lemon recipe for a green kitchen disinfectant spray
![]() |
| Lemon spray |
Fill spray bottle with one cup each of water, one cup alcohol, and 1 lemon juice. This disinfectant should be used as needed and kept in a spray bottle. Because lemon loses its potency over time, it is advisable to produce modest amounts while preparing it.
Homemade recipe for scrubbing in the kitchen
![]() |
| lemon with baking soda |
Mix the baking soda with the freshly squeezed lemon juice to form a paste. Clean bathtubs, tile, and sinks with this paste.

Q- How can I remove stains from my plates with lemon?
Ans- Here's a simple lemon-based dishwashing method.
- Slice a lemon: Half the lemon.
- Scrub the dishes: To remove stains from the plates, use half a lemon. Lemons' acidity dissolves grime. To extract the juice, gently squeeze the lemon.
- Allow it to sit for ten to fifteen minutes after thoroughly cleaning the entire soiled area with lemon juice. This prolongs the time that the citric acid has to react with the pigment.
- Clean and Rinse: Use warm water to rinse the plate. In case the stain remains, you can carry out this procedure once again. Wash the dishes as normal after the stain has been gone.
Note that glass and ceramic plates are the ideal candidates for this technique.

Q: Can a lemon help cut through fat on dishes? How can I make the most of its efficacy?
Ans- Indeed, lemons naturally degrease surfaces. Because of the citric acid in it, grease is reduced.
Utilize these suggestions to increase effectiveness:
a) First warm up the pan on the stove then squeeze lemon juice directly onto the greased area. Scrub it. Grease will go in seconds .
b) Soak the greased dishes in warm water and squeeze lemon in this warm water.
c) You can also use lemon juice directly into the diluted dishwashing liquid in hot water
d) don't waste lemon peels. Instead cut these into small pieces and add them to dishwash purchased from the market. Use it as needed.
